Hr Generalist

Surrey, BC, CA, Canada

Job Description

About Glen Group



Glen Group is a dynamic and fast-growing organization dedicated to providing high-quality services across multiple industries, including traffic control, security, construction, and management. With a strong foundation built on integrity, innovation, and service excellence, we are committed to delivering value to our clients and fostering growth within our teams.

Our Commitment to Diversity and Inclusion



At Glen Group, we believe that diversity drives innovation and inclusion builds stronger teams. We are committed to creating a workplace where everyone feels respected, valued, and empowered to thrive--regardless of race, gender, ethnicity, religion, sexual orientation, or background. We actively promote equity, fairness, and opportunity in every aspect of our hiring, operations, and company culture.

About the Role



We are seeking a highly organized and detail-oriented

HR Generalist

to join our team. This is a hands-on role requiring strong knowledge of employment standards, union laws, and HR best practices. The HR Generalist will be responsible for recruitment, compliance, benefits administration, and employee relations, while also supporting HR operations through tools like

Rippling HRS

and

ATS systems

.

Key Responsibilities



Manage full-cycle recruitment for a variety of roles, including security, forklift operators, traffic controllers, and other positions. Ensure compliance with employment standards, union agreements, and internal policies. Represent the organization at

job fairs

and community hiring events. Plan and support

company events in Richmond

. Administer employee benefits and provide guidance on entitlements. Maintain accuracy in job details such as salary, hours, shifts, and other role-specific requirements. Conduct

employer exit interviews

and provide feedback for organizational improvements. Handle HR systems and processes, including

Rippling HRS

and ATS platforms. Support employee onboarding, performance management, and ongoing HR initiatives. Maintain accurate and confidential employee records.

Qualifications & Skills



Proven experience in HR or as an HR Generalist, preferably in a unionized environment. Strong knowledge of employment standards, union laws, and HR compliance requirements. Excellent recruitment skills, with the ability to handle multiple roles across different functions. Highly

detail-oriented

, with the ability to manage and recall complex information (e.g., varying job requirements, schedules, and pay structures). Strong organizational and time-management skills with the ability to prioritize effectively. Exceptional interpersonal and communication skills. Proficiency in HRIS/ATS systems (experience with Rippling is an asset). Ability to work independently while collaborating across teams.

Location:

Surrey, BC (with occasional travel to Richmond for company events)

Job Type:

Full-Time

Salary:

$3,500 per month

What We're Looking For


We're seeking an

all-rounder HR professional

who combines compliance knowledge with excellent people skills, a keen eye for detail, and the ability to manage multiple moving parts without losing sight of the basics.

Job Types: Full-time, Permanent

Pay: $45,000.00-$50,000.00 per year

Benefits:

Company events Dental care Extended health care Vision care
Application question(s):

Are you comfortable supporting multiple companies under the Glen Group umbrella, not just one? Have you previously worked in a HR role in British Columbia? How many years of office coordination or administrative experience do you have? What HRIS systems/tools have you used? Tell us about a time when you had to support multiple departments or teams. How did you prioritize your tasks? What does professionalism and confidentiality mean to you in an office setting? Are you open to taking on tasks outside your job scope as the company evolves? If yes, give an example. Are you comfortable working full-time on-site (this is not a remote position)?
Work Location: In person

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2881900
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Surrey, BC, CA, Canada
  • Education
    Not mentioned